What Are Autonomous Construction Machines?
Autonomous construction machines are vehicles and tools that can operate independently or with minimal human intervention. Equipped with advanced sensors, GPS, and artificial intelligence, these machines can perform tasks such as excavation, lifting, grading, and drilling with high accuracy.
Types of Autonomous Construction Equipment
- Autonomous Excavators
- Self-driving Dump Trucks
- Robotic Cranes
- Automated Graders
- Drone Surveyors
Benefits of Autonomous Construction Machinery
- Increased Safety: Reducing human presence in hazardous zones.
- Higher Efficiency: Faster project completion times.
- Enhanced Precision: Improved accuracy in measurements and placements.
- Cost Savings: Lower labor and operational costs over time.
Challenges and Future Outlook
Despite the many advantages, integrating autonomous machinery faces challenges such as high initial costs, technical reliability, and regulatory hurdles. However, ongoing advancements in AI and robotics are expected to make these systems more accessible and reliable in the coming years.
